Set-WFCertificate

Set-WFCertificate

Este cmdlet se puede usar para establecer o cambiar el certificado SSL o el EncryptionCertificate.

Sintaxis

Parameter Set: AutoCert
Set-WFCertificate [-WFFarmDBConnectionString <String> ] [ <CommonParameters>]

Parameter Set: BothSslAndEncryption
Set-WFCertificate -EncryptionCertificateThumbprint <String> -SslCertificateThumbprint <String> [-WFFarmDBConnectionString <String> ] [ <CommonParameters>]

Parameter Set: OnlyEncryption
Set-WFCertificate -EncryptionCertificateThumbprint <String> [-WFFarmDBConnectionString <String> ] [ <CommonParameters>]

Parameter Set: OnlySsl
Set-WFCertificate -SslCertificateThumbprint <String> [-WFFarmDBConnectionString <String> ] [ <CommonParameters>]

Descripción detallada

Ejecute Set-WFCertificate para cambiar la SslCertificateThumbprint y el EncryptionCertificate. Tras ejecutar este cmdlet, ejecute Update-WFHost en todos los host para aportar el certificado nuevo al host.

Parámetros

-EncryptionCertificateThumbprint<String>

Este certificado se utiliza para asegurar las cadenas de conexión SQL. Si no se proporciona, obtendrá el valor de SslCertificate. Representa el certificado de cifrado.

Alias

ninguna

¿Necesario?

true

¿Posición?

named

Valor predeterminado

ninguna

¿Aceptar la entrada de la canalización?

false

¿Aceptar caracteres comodín?

false

-SslCertificateThumbprint<String>

Representa el certificado que se usa para la seguridad de la comunicación del servicio. No proporcione esto si se usa el valor CertAutogenerationKey para la generación automática de certificados.

Alias

ninguna

¿Necesario?

true

¿Posición?

named

Valor predeterminado

ninguna

¿Aceptar la entrada de la canalización?

false

¿Aceptar caracteres comodín?

false

-WFFarmDBConnectionString<String>

Representa una cadena de conexión de la base de datos de configuración.

Alias

ninguna

¿Necesario?

false

¿Posición?

named

Valor predeterminado

ninguna

¿Aceptar la entrada de la canalización?

false

¿Aceptar caracteres comodín?

false

<CommonParameters>

Este cmdlet admite parámetros comunes: -Verbose, -Debug, -ErrorAction, -ErrorVariable, -OutBuffer y -OutVariable. Para obtener más información, vea about_CommonParameters

Entradas

El tipo de entrada es el tipo de objetos que se pueden canalizar al cmdlet.

Salidas

El tipo de resultado es el tipo de los objetos que el cmdlet emite.

Ejemplos

Ejemplo

Establecer los certificados SSL y la EncryptionCertificate .

PS C:\> Set-WFCertificate –SslCertificateThumbprint  “wfsslcert.pfx”  –EncryptionCertificateThumbprint “encryptioncert.pfx”

Workflow Manager 1.0 MSDN Community Forum